About the Role
We are looking for a detail-oriented and proactive Material Planner to join our Supply Chain this role you will ensure the timely availability of materials required for the production of high-precision electron microscopes and spectroscopy systems. You will play a key role in balancing material availability inventory levels and production demands in a dynamic international manufacturing environment.
Key Responsibilities
- Plan and manage material requirements based on production forecasts and customer orders
- Ensure timely procurement and availability of components and raw materials
- Monitor inventory levels and optimize stock to meet service and cost targets
- Collaborate closely with Procurement Production Engineering and Logistics teams
- Proactively mitigate supply risks
- Manage master data in ERP/MRP systems
- Participate in continuous improvement initiatives within the Supply Chain function
- Support new product introduction (NPI) projects from a planning perspective
